An article by Sean Ironman (Creative Writing M.F.A. ’14) was recently published in The Writer’s Chronicle, the national magazine from the Association of Writers & Writing Programs.

“Writing the Z-Axis: Reflection and the Nonfiction Workshop” appears in the September 2014 issue. For over four decades, The Writer’s Chronicle has served as a leading source of articles, news, and information for writers, editors, students, and teachers of writing.

Sean is now a Visiting Assistant Professor of Digital Media and Creative Writing at the University of Central Arkansas. His work, in the form of essays, comics, book reviews, and art, has been published in a variety of outlets including Redivider, Thoreau’s Rooster, and The Florida Review.

He was recently awarded an Honorable Mention in Creative Nonfiction in AWP’s Intro Journals Project Awards. In 2013, he won 2nd prize in UCF’s “Why Writing Matters” contest.
